二维码巡检系统软件开发实现如何划分环节
有开发需求的客户可以在文章上方留言给我们,我们会在两个工作日内与您取得联系。
二维码巡检系统软件开发实现如何划分环节
随着我国经济的快速发展,工业生产规模逐渐扩大,设备巡检工作日益繁重,且传统的人工巡检方式存在效率低下、数据不准确等问题。为解决这些问题,提高设备巡检效率,降低维护成本,二维码巡检系统应运而生。本文将详细介绍二维码巡检系统软件开发实现的各个环节划分。
一、需求分析
在进行软件开发之前,首先需要进行需求分析。需求分析是软件开发的第一步,也是关键的一步。需求分析的主要目的是了解用户的需求,明确软件的功能、性能、可靠性、可维护性等方面的要求。对于二维码巡检系统来说,需求分析的主要任务包括以下几个方面:
1. 确定巡检对象:分析需要进行巡检的设备、设施、区域等,明确巡检范围。
2. 确定巡检内容:分析巡检的具体内容,如设备运行状况、设备参数、安全措施等,明确巡检的具体要求。
3. 确定巡检周期:根据设备的运行特点和维护要求,合理设定巡检周期。
4. 确定巡检人员:明确负责巡检的工作人员及其职责。
5. 确定数据存储和分析要求:分析巡检数据的存储、查询、统计、分析等需求。
6. 确定系统兼容性要求:分析系统在不同平台、设备上的兼容性要求。
二、系统设计
系统设计是根据需求分析的结果,进行软件系统的整体结构和模块划分的设计。系统设计的主要任务包括以下几个方面:
1. 系统架构设计:根据需求分析结果,设计系统的整体架构,包括模块划分、模块间的接口设计等。
2. 数据库设计:根据需求分析中的数据存储和分析要求,设计数据库的结构、表结构等。
3. 界面设计:根据需求分析中的系统兼容性要求,设计不同平台、设备上的界面。
4. 模块划分:将系统划分为若干个功能模块,如设备管理模块、巡检任务模块、数据采集模块、数据分析模块等。
三、软件开发
软件开发阶段是根据系统设计的结果,编写程序代码,实现软件的各项功能。软件开发的主要任务包括以下几个方面:
1. 编写程序代码:根据系统设计的要求,编写各个模块的程序代码。
2. 调试程序:对编写的程序代码进行调试,确保程序的正确性和稳定性。
3. 测试:对整个系统进行功能测试、性能测试、兼容性测试等,确保系统满足需求分析中的各项要求。
四、系统部署与维护
系统部署与维护阶段是将开发完成的软件系统部署到用户的设备上,并进行运行维护。系统部署与维护的主要任务包括以下几个方面:
1. 系统部署:将开发完成的软件系统部署到用户的设备上,并确保软件能够正常运行。
2. 用户培训:对用户进行系统使用培训,确保用户能够熟练操作并维护系统。
3. 系统维护:对系统进行运行维护,确保系统的稳定性和安全性。
4. 系统升级:根据用户的需求和系统运行情况,对系统进行功能升级和优化。
总之,二维码巡检系统软件开发实现需要经过需求分析、系统设计、软件开发、系统部署与维护四个环节。每个环节都有其独特的任务和目标,只有严格遵循这些环节,才能确保软件开发过程的顺利进行,最终实现高质量的二维码巡检系统。
有开发需求的客户可以在文章上方留言给我们,我们会在两个工作日内与您取得联系。